Vertebral Compression Fracture Devices Market - Global Industry Insights, and Opportunity Analysis 2025
The micro-breaks in the building blocks of vertebra mainly caused by bone-thinning are termed as vertebral compression fractures (VCFs). Vertebral compression fracture occurs due to compression of a single bone due to trauma. The surgical approach for VCF treatment comprises injecting bone cement through a small hole in the fractured vertebra to provide immediate pain relief and stabilization to the patient. The cementing material provides a scaffold for the spine bone for added support. Thinning of corticles, reduction in bone mineral density, and osteoporosis are the major factors causing vertebral compression fractures. Postmenopausal women are more prone to vertebral fractures. The ultimate goal of the vertebral compression fracture devices is to eliminate back pain, fuse and repair fractures, restore posture, and provide ease of movement.Kyphoplasty and vertebroplasty are the evolved techniques of osteoporotic compression. Kyphoplasty is done on patients with severe pain even after weeks of non-operative or drug-related treatment. The technique involves expansion for cavity formation and cement injection that can be done with less pressure. Vertebroplasty is not generally recommended by American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ons (AAOS), owing to the higher rates of extravasation and increased complications with no beneficial effects.

Rising prevalence of osteoporosis drives the vertebral compression fracture devices market
According to the International Osteoporosis Foundation estimates in 2010, osteoporosis affects 200 million people globally with approximate 9 million new osteoporotic fractures, with 1.6 million hip fractures, 1.7 million forearm fractures, and 1.4 million clinical vertebral fractures. The rising incidence of arthritis and osteoporosis, inability of medicinal therapy to cure vertebral compression fracture to the optimum level, and the advent of minimally invasive spine surgeries drives the growth of vertebral compression fracture devices market. Moreover, short recovery period, low risk of infection, limited hospital stay, and rise in geriatric population are projected to boost the demand for VCF devices globally. However, stringent regulatory approval process and the risk of post-surgical complications such as neurological injury and compromised pulmonary function are expected to restrain the market growth.

According to the World Health Organization estimates in 2015, vertebral compression fractures (VCF) are the common type of fragility fractures with 700,000 VCF cases per year in the U.S., with 30% postmenopausal women likely to experience humerus, hip, and spine fractures, thereby propelling the demand for innovative VCF devices.
